/** |
|
* @brief Flash partition |
|
* |
|
* This structure represents a fixed-size partition on a flash device. |
|
* Each partition contains one or more flash sectors. |
|
*/ |
|
struct flash_area { |
|
/** ID number */ |
|
uint8_t fa_id; |
|
uint16_t pad16; |
|
/** Start offset from the beginning of the flash device */ |
|
off_t fa_off; |
|
/** Total size */ |
|
size_t fa_size; |
|
/** Backing flash device */ |
|
const struct device *fa_dev; |
|
#if CONFIG_FLASH_MAP_LABELS |
|
/** Partition label if defined in DTS. Otherwise nullptr; */ |
|
const char *fa_label; |
|
#endif |
|
}; |

/** |
|
* @brief Retrieve partitions flash area from the flash_map. |
|
* |
|
* Function Retrieves flash_area from flash_map for given partition. |
|
* |
|
* @param[in] id ID of the flash partition. |
|
* @param[out] fa Pointer which has to reference flash_area. If |
|
* @p ID is unknown, it will be NULL on output. |
|
* |
|
* @return 0 on success, -EACCES if the flash_map is not available , |
|
* -ENOENT if @p ID is unknown, -ENODEV if there is no driver attached |
|
* to the area. |
|
*/ |
|
int flash_area_open(uint8_t id, const struct flash_area **fa); |
|
|
|
/** |
|
* @brief Close flash_area |
|
* |
|
* Reserved for future usage and external projects compatibility reason. |
|
* Currently is NOP. |
|
* |
|
* @param[in] fa Flash area to be closed. |
|
*/ |
|
void flash_area_close(const struct flash_area *fa); |

/** |
|
* @brief Erase flash area or fill with erase-value |
|
* |
|
* On program-erase devices this function behaves exactly like flash_area_erase. |
|
* On RAM non-volatile device it will call erase, if driver provides such |
|
* callback, or will fill given range with erase-value defined by driver. |
|
* This function should be only used by code that has not been written |
|
* to directly support devices that do not require erase and rely on |
|
* device being erased prior to some operations. |
|
* Note that emulated erase, on devices that do not require, is done |
|
* via write, which affects endurance of device. |
|
* |
|
* @see flash_area_erase() |
|
* @see flash_flatten() |
|
* |
|
* @param[in] fa Flash area |
|
* @param[in] off Offset relative from beginning of flash area. |
|
* @param[in] len Number of bytes to be erase |
|
* |
|
* @return 0 on success, negative errno code on fail. |
|
*/ |
|
int flash_area_flatten(const struct flash_area *fa, off_t off, size_t len); |
